About this property
Spacious Victorian perfect for large groups. Walk to Main Street!
This restored Victorian is spacious, comfortable and sunny, perfect for large groups and families. The home has a well-appointed Kitchen with everything you need to make and serve wonderful meals. Living Room opens into the Dining Room with French doors out to deck that has a grill and seating. 3 bedrooms and 1 full bath upstairs. 1 bedroom and 1 full bath downstairs. Built in 1898, this home has all the charm of a late Victorian but with modern comforts. Located in Hannibal’s Central Park Historic District. Just a 4 block walk to downtown and Main Street.
We are child friendly but you must bring any child safety accessories you require. We are also Pet Friendly - for pets who travel well. The Pet Fee is $75 PER PET. Advance approval is REQUIRED, and subject to House Rules.
This home is perfect for guests who are seeking an authentic historic home experience. In the home's renovation we have preserved as many original features as possible. These historic features (such as original woodwork, windows, sinks and toilets, kitchen cabinetry) show their age and beauty in the form of patina. Our design approach is to be sensitive to the homes past and embrace its authentic historic features. We do not rip everything out and create a modern day home inside. Yet we have many modern amenities in the home, such as Central Air Conditioning, WIFI and Roku TV.
